The Role
We recognise the importance and complexity families face when choosing a kindergarten or child care service. In this role you will be the first friendly face families meet on their journey with BPA Children’s Services. You will be able to make a positive impact on those initial stages that families and our service leaders work though.
Specifically managing areas such as enquiries, wait lists, enrolments and welcome processes. This role is reporting through to the Communications & Marketing Manger and will also engage in events and activities that promote our kindergarten and child care services.
Why BPA?
BPA has a proud history of providing truly excellent early education and care to the diverse communities of Melbourne’s West.
For us, the bottom line is safe, inclusive and equitable early learning. A non-profit organisation led by a skills-based board, our purpose is to support every child to flourish in safe, accessible, equitable and culturally-responsive early education and care, regardless of their family background or circumstances.
We pride ourselves on the quality of the early learning we provide: 75% of our centres are rated “Exceeding”, the highest level obtainable under the National Quality Standard.
